Rivers Edge

Simms Fishing Products has acquired Rivers Edge, a company that was previously part of The Rivers Edge. The Bozeman-based company has been a leader in the field for decades. Recently, Simms Fishing Products acquired The Rivers Edge Fly Shop. The Rivers Edge, founded in 1983, has been the center of Montana fly fishing. The company has two Bozeman locations and provides everything you need, including expert product advice and guided Montana flyfishing trips.

Sage Foundation Outfit

The Sage Foundation Outfit is the perfect fly fishing combo for beginners and intermediates alike. The 4-piece rod has Graphite IIIe blank technology, which allows for easy casting. Its matte black finish with a snubnose provides excellent line feel. Furthermore, the reel's carbon sealed drag system, which is carbon carbon, blocks out grit sand and other inhibitors. This combo includes a Spectrum C Reel, RIO Gold Fly Line backing, and a protective Rod Case.
